Output 26e3069a6ca18c8a28ab820ab5c27df54b7d3de63d40df431b9703ba47d4954a:3

value
28090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6540d8b50f3a84d57e1e486b6e05dec093c46a4 OP_EQUAL
address
3GrUnV941zcdwn5exFvCXBTVhzPi4ACAEN
transaction
26e3069a6ca18c8a28ab820ab5c27df54b7d3de63d40df431b9703ba47d4954a
spent
true